The Church of St. Benedict was built at the beginning of the 19th century in the neo-Classical architectural style. It was designed by Gaspero Pampaloni to honor the legacy of St. Benedict. The father of Tuscan neo-Classicism, Pasquale Poccianti, also contributed to the look of the church. The interior houses beautiful oil paintings and a Greek cross set on four pillars.
